Exciting Events at Carryduff Library This April
Published 01 Apr 2025
Carryduff Library is bringing stories, wildlife and practical learning to life this April with a series of free events for all ages. From musical storytelling to reptiles and pet care, there’s something to spark every imagination.
Yarnspinners with Karen Edwards
Wednesday 2 April 6:30pm – 7:30pm
Enjoy an evening of storytelling and music as Karen Edwards entertains with tales and tunes on her traditional whistles.
Booking essential – contact the library to reserve your place.
USPCA – Care For Your Pets
Friday 11 April 10:15am – 11:00am
Children aged 4 - 6 years are invited to learn how to care for their pets and meet the USPCA’s life-like dog. A great way to build compassion and responsibility in young animal lovers.
Amazon Jungle Show
Monday 14 April 2:15pm – 3:15pm
The jungle is coming to Carryduff! Come along and meet some incredible Amazon reptiles, including slithery snakes and colourful chameleons – all under expert supervision.
These events are free to attend, but booking is required for some sessions. For more information or to book your place, contact Carryduff Library directly on t: 028 9081 3568 or e: carryduff.library@librariesni.org.uk
